    Garry Marr: Will falling house prices delay your retirement?

    Home prices proceed to fall or stay flat in main centres across the country , a possible predicament for these relying on their properties as a part of their retirement plans .

    The Toronto Regional Real Estate Board reported this week that in Canada’s largest metropolis the common promoting worth was $1,051,969 in April, down 4.9 per cent from a yr earlier. Based mostly on the index, costs have fallen greater than 20 per cent from the height. The story is similar elsewhere ; Vancouver home costs have been off virtually seven per cent from a yr in the past in April.

    For the fourth quarter of 2025, family residential actual property was down 0.2 per cent from a yr in the past to $8,450.6 billion, in line with the newest information from Statistics Canada. The excellent news is that on the identical time, the worth of all property, minus all liabilities, elevated for Canadians by $230.2 billion to $18,594.9 billion.

    In fact, wealth is just not unfold evenly throughout Canada, and 20 per cent of the nation has about 65 per cent of the online value, in line with Statistics Canada, with many benefiting from an S&P/TSX Composite index that was up 28.2 per cent in 2025 and is up about one other seven per cent this yr.

    The issue is for individuals who have loads of their wealth tied up of their principal residence and who could also be seeking to faucet into that cash in some unspecified time in the future of their retirement. It’s simply not value as a lot now.

    And though there’s little query that long-time owners have seen large appreciation of their property nest eggs , will the dip in actual property values over the previous two years make sufficient of a distinction for some folks to should rethink their retirement plans?

    Robert Kavcic, a senior economist with Financial institution of Montreal, stated pockets throughout markets can differ, however some cities similar to Toronto and Vancouver might see costs staying flat or happening. “Incomes should catch as much as affordability,” he stated.

    If your private home is 50 per cent of your web value — which could not be uncommon for somebody with a indifferent dwelling value $1 million or $2 million in Toronto or Vancouver — do you have to lose $200,000 to $400,000, how a lot would your retirement pondering change?

    The fairness development older Canadians have already constructed could not materially impact the retirement revenue from their properties, stated Kavcic. “Anybody close to retirement age (has) greater than a decade of fairness (development), so you might be scraping off 20 per cent however you in all probability didn’t set your retirement plan based mostly on 5 years in the past,” he stated. Housing wealth is like paper wealth in your stability sheet and doesn’t change your money circulate, he added.

    Nonetheless, it’s dangerous to depend on downsizing to fund retirement, stated licensed monetary planner Jason Heath.

    “In observe, I see loads of retirees who age in place and don’t downsize. Even those that figured they might downsize in retirement earlier on of their monetary lives, (don’t),” he stated. “One thing that I fear about slightly is folks holding on for a restoration in hopes of timing the market.”

    “The place do folks go?” requested Jason Mercer, the Toronto Regional Actual Property Board’s chief data officer, referring to the shortage of different housing downsizing choices for retirees to maneuver to to allow them to faucet into their housing wealth.

    For many who deliberate to extract worth out of their dwelling whereas residing there, Dan Eisner, founder and chief govt of True North Mortgage, stated whereas he doesn’t see many individuals heading into retirement with debt, even a paid-off dwelling is hard to leverage as a result of a standard mortgage mortgage will likely be exhausting to qualify for in retirement.

    “The reverse mortgage has change into extra fashionable,” stated Eisner, concerning the product that typically lets you entry 55 per cent of the fairness in your house with no mortgage funds. Nonetheless, finally it chips away on the fairness in your house as soon as you progress.

    “The largest distinction with a mortgage dwelling fairness line of credit score (or HELOC) is it’s important to have the revenue to assist the fee; a reverse mortgage, you don’t want that.”

    However as costs go down, reverse mortgages are affected. “Your property simply isn’t value as a lot,” Eisner stated. “Even if you happen to simply need to take some cash and put it into a few of the exchange-traded funds for revenue, your cash is value much less. So that’s regarding.”

    Anthony Scilipoto, president and chief govt of Veritas Group of Firms, stated the rapid impression of the decline is the so-called “wealth impact,” which is the concept that folks spend extra once they understand they’ve more cash.

    “It doesn’t matter how wealthy you might be. You begin pondering slightly in a different way,” stated Scilipoto, about paper losses. “Issues simply begin bothering you. You reduce slightly bit since you are down. You do one thing rather less costly.”

    Would folks really work slightly longer if their properties have been now not rising in worth? Scilipoto stated perhaps, however it will depend on how a lot of your own home is your nest egg. “This could all get exacerbated if now we have a inventory market downturn,” stated Scilipoto.

    Heath stated some owners could delay retirement and work slightly longer if their properties have dropped in worth, however stated he believes inventory market publicity could insulate them.

    The opposite impression could be what these values say to youthful generations as they watch a housing market that doesn’t do all that a lot.

    “Folks could rethink giving cash to their youngsters to purchase a home … (as) simply not a superb funding,” stated Scilipoto. “We’re already seeing this.”

    Housing could make sense behaviourally since you get a mortgage and have a pressured financial savings plan. The federal government even encourages folks to raid their retirement funds for as much as $60,000 and pay it again over 15 years to get into the housing market.

    However the flaw within the house-as-retirement-piggy-bank plan is that it’s important to promote it or borrow in opposition to it to entry the cash.

    And if dwelling values don’t rise, and even fall additional, the concept of a home as a retirement nest egg is wanting damaged.
